The logo thing is a mix bag: I Think we could appease Many this wearing it 3 times

The UConn brand was so all over the place. Women's and Men's basketball had their own logo. Baseball had a C. Football had a block C. And we have a happy dog logo and the word "UConn cursive logo". We were all over the place with marketing, our logo situation was a mess. It confused TV & Media outlets as they would use the incorrect logos (ie woman's for men's logos on TV & internet scoreboards) I really could not recall a school that had so many different logos for each sport. Nike came up with a mean looking husky to become our brand and unique identifier. And I truly believe it was 100% the correct move.

And as much as us couch potatoes like the classier block C.... the kids, I would bet, want the mean looking dog on their helmets.

The Oregon stuff is crazy but we have seen that kids have committed to Oregon because they like Nike and the crazy unis. We need all the help we can get and we need the crazy unis and a mean dog...The Block C is for grandma & grandpa.


My two cents.I think each year/season we have a game where we explain the history, trailers etc..... of our program to the kids and we wear the Block C unis for a game. This will let us relive the glory days for a few games a year and still keep us current with the mean dog. I would push to wear the block C if we play an old big east team as a "throwback" game so to speak. We must wear the block C against Syracuse, USF and Cincy
